I am moving from a large Kindergarten classroom, with a lot of storage, into a small First Grade classroom. My students deserve to have a clutter free place to learn and grow. These small things will help them to stay organized with their materials, and writing tools. As many of my students do not have money to buy school supplies, this allows me to provide supplies, and then they will have a place to keep their personal belongings. It will also keep their reading close by, so any time they finish their work they can read their books. That means more reading in my classroom! Your support is greatly appreciated as it will give them more responsibility, and help them to care about our classroom space.
